Burlingame Hills, Burlingame, CA Local Guide

How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Burlingame Hills?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Burlingame Hills Studio Apartments | $3,486 | $3,089 | $4,078 |
| Burlingame Hills 1 Bedroom Apartments | $4,252 | $2,500 | $5,776 |
| Burlingame Hills 2 Bedroom Apartments | $5,924 | $3,200 | $7,054 |
| Burlingame Hills 3 Bedroom Apartments | $7,411 | $7,411 | $7,411 |
How much does it cost to rent a home in Burlingame Hills?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| 2 Bedroom Homes | $4,456 | $3,875 | $4,995 |
| 3 Bedroom Homes | $5,923 | $5,295 | $6,200 |
| 4 Bedroom Homes | $11,800 | $7,800 | $10,000+ |
| 5 Bedroom Homes | $30,000 | $10,000 | $10,000+ |
| 6 Bedroom Homes | $18,999 | $10,000 | $10,000+ |
